What are the most common dermatology services available to residents of Beeson, WV?

Local and regional dermatology clinics serving the Beeson area commonly provide skin cancer screenings (especially important given potential sun exposure in rural settings), treatment for acne and eczema, and management of chronic conditions like psoriasis. Many also offer procedures such as mole removal, treatment of warts, and biopsies for suspicious skin lesions, which are essential for early detection in areas with limited specialist access.

What should I know about insurance and payment for dermatology visits near Beeson?

Most dermatology practices in Southern West Virginia, including those serving Beeson patients, accept major insurance plans like Medicare, Medicaid, and private insurers common to the region such as The Health Plan or Highmark Blue Cross Blue Shield. It is highly recommended to verify coverage with both your insurance provider and the dermatology office before your appointment, as some specialized procedures or treatments may require prior authorization.

Are there dermatologists in the region who specialize in conditions common to West Virginia, like skin cancer or occupational skin issues?

Yes, dermatologists practicing in Southern West Virginia often have significant experience with skin cancer detection and treatment, which is a priority in Appalachian communities. Some also develop expertise in occupational dermatology related to local industries, such as treating contact dermatitis from plants or chemicals encountered in farming, forestry, or outdoor work common in the Beeson area.

What is the typical process for getting a follow-up appointment or consultation after an initial visit with a dermatologist near Beeson?

Follow-up care is typically scheduled before you leave your initial appointment, as securing timely slots can be important. Many clinics now offer patient portals for easier communication and prescription refills. For non-urgent follow-ups, be prepared for potential wait times of several weeks to a few months, so scheduling well in advance is advised to ensure continuity of care.
